RARE.An early work to be illustrated with actual photographs. A record of the plant-related exhibits of the Fifth World Exhibition and the first in the German-speaking world. The images here concentrate on the Japanese Garden. As early as June 8 1872 the construction progress on the site was documented photographically. The images were offered for sale in a separate pavilion. The entire image production comprised around 2200 images. These were published in 1874 in the "General Catalog of Photographic Products of the Vienna Photographers' Association for the World Exhibition 1873". This expertly-annotated bibliography describes hundreds of books and periodicals on British architectural design and practice 1715-1842. Each entry includes commentary on the author's ideas and detailed discussion of text and plates. Later editions and reprints through 1950 are also identified. Winner of Choice Magazine's award for Outstanding Academic Book. A lengthy introduction discusses architecture and the book trade format and content of the books aspects of architectural theory and design dwelling types such as villas cottages row houses housing for laborers and town and village planning etc. Bound in the original maroon cloth stamped in bright white on the spine. From the dust jacket: "This is the first major study to trace the evolution of architectural ideas during the 18th- and 19th-century by examining the literary output of architects Most of the book is devoted to descriptions of hundreds of books and periodicals containing original designs for domestic structures.
